Ingredients
To make the delicious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ad, you’ll need the following ingredients:
For the Pasta Salad Base
- 12 oz bow-tie pasta or similar short pasta
- 2 cups cooked turkey, chopped
- 1/2 cup diced celery
For Flavor and Crunch
- 2/3 cup dried cranberries
- 1/3 cup toasted chopped pecans or almonds
- 1/4 cup sliced green onions
For Dressing
- 2/3 cup prepared poppy seed dressing
- 1/3 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tbsp apple cider vinegar
- 1 tsp granulated sugar (optional)
Servings: 4
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 85 minutes
How to Make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Start by boiling water in a large pot. Add the bow-tie pasta and cook according to package instructions until al dente. Drain the pasta using a colander and rinse it under cold water to stop cooking.
Step 2: Prepare Other Ingredients
While the pasta cools, chop the cooked turkey into bite-sized pieces. Dice the celery, slice the green onions, and toast your pecans or almonds if they aren’t already toasted.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led pasta with chopped turkey, diced celery, dried cranberries, toasted nuts, and sliced green onions.
Step 4: Make the Dressing
In a separate bowl, mix together poppy seed dressing, m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, and optional sugar until well combined.
Step 5: Toss Everything Together
Pour the dressing over the pasta mixture and stir gently until all ingredients are evenly coated. Adjust seasoning if needed.
Step 6: Chill Before Serving
Cover the salad with plastic wrap or transfer to an airtight container. Chill in your refrigerator for at least an hour before serving to enhance flavors.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ad, it’s easy to overlook a few key details. Here are some common mistakes to watch out for:
-
Skipping the pasta timing: Overcooked pasta can ruin the texture of your salad. Always follow the package instructions for cooking time and check for al dente doneness.
-
Ignoring ingredient freshness: Using wilted vegetables or stale nuts can diminish flavor. Always choose fresh produce and store nuts properly to maintain their crunch.
-
Not measuring dressings accurately: Too much dressing can make your salad soggy. Use measuring cups to ensure you add the right amount of poppy seed dressing and mayonnaise.
-
Forgetting to chill: Serving your salad warm can mask its flavors. Chill it in the fridge for at least one hour before serving for the best taste.
-
Neglecting seasoning adjustments: Seasoning is essential for flavor. Taste your salad before serving and adjust with salt, pepper, or a splash more vinegar if necessary.

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ions regarding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ad:
What can I substitute for turkey in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ad?
You can use cooked chicken or even chickpeas for a vegetarian option that adds protein.
Can I make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ad ahead of time?
Yes! This salad tastes better after marinating, so feel free to prepare it a day in advance and store it in the fridge.
How do I customize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ad?
Add fruits like diced apples or grapes, or include additional veggies such as bell peppers or spinach for extra color and flavor.
How long does Bow-Tie Cranberry Pasta Salad last?
It stays fresh in the refrigerator for up to three days when stored properly in an airtight container.
